The Eastmark Firebirds will head out to face off against the Desert Sunrise Golden Hawks at 11:00 a.m. on Saturday. The squads are rolling into the game with opposing streaks: Eastmark has struggled recently with five losses in a row, while Desert Sunrise will arrive with three straight wins.

On Thursday, Eastmark came up short against Crismon and fell 6-2.

Eastmark saw four different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Austin Snyder, who went 1-for-3 with two RBI.

Meanwhile, Desert Sunrise's hitters rose to the challenge against a Criminals pitching crew that boasted an average of only 3.43 runs allowed on Thursday. Desert Sunrise walked away with an 11-7 victory over Yuma.

The team relied heavily on Jacoby Garcia, who scored a run while going 2-for-3. Another player making a difference was Alexander Vale, who scored a run while getting on base in three of his four plate appearances.

Desert Sunrise was getting hits left and right and finished the game having posted a batting average of .444. The team's really been improving in that area: they've now improved their batting average total in three consecutive contests.

Eastmark's defeat dropped their record down to 3-8. As for Desert Sunrise, they now have a winning record of 3-2-1.
